Smooth, symmetrical, firm oval lump in cheek tissue? about an inch in diameter and movable. could this be a lipoma? can you get lipomas in the cheek?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

A lipoma in the cheek is rare and contains fat cells .Usually they are found on head, neck and shoulder. If removed they rarely grow back. They are non cancerous.
